Product Features Model: ASUS TUF-GAMING-750G MPN: 90YE00S3-B0NA00 SKU: TUF GAMING 750W GOLD Type: Power Supply Unit (PSU) Brand / Series: ASUS / TUF Power Output: 750 Watts Efficiency Rating: 80 PLUS Gold Design: Fully Modular Cooling: Dual ball-bearing fan Build Standard: Military-grade certified components Colour: Black Dimensions: 150 x 86 x 150 mm (WxHxD) Weight: 2.38kg Most Suitable For: Gaming PCs and high-end desktop builds Warranty: 10 Years Manufacturer Warranty Looking for other components?
